Where is the Selepes family from?

You can see how Selepes families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Selepes family name was found in the USA in 1920. In 1920 there was 1 Selepes family living in Pennsylvania. This was 100% of all the recorded Selepes's in USA. Pennsylvania had the highest population of Selepes families in 1920.

What did your Selepes ancestors do for a living?

In 1940, Bench Worker was the top reported job for people in the USA named Selepes. 50% of Selepes men worked as a Bench Worker.

What is the average Selepes lifespan?

Between 1970 and 2002, in the United States, Selepes life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1982, and highest in 2002. The average life expectancy for Selepes in 1970 was 58, and 93 in 2002.

An unusually short lifespan might indicate that your Selepes ancestors lived in harsh conditions. A short lifespan might also indicate health problems that were once prevalent in your family.
